It's a PITA to debug since it'll >> be a very early panic. I'd rather have the system log errors in dmesg >> but continue booting with one cpu. > > Actually the first version of this series continued on one CPU if TF > support was missing (as secondary CPUs would simply fail to boot), but > IIRC Stephen advocated for the current behavior (panic) instead. I > agree such an early panic is hard to debug, especially considering > that most devices using TF (Tegra retail devices) do not even feature > a serial port. > > On the other hand, if we continue booting in these conditions the > system freezes as soon as cpuidle kicks in, so we won't be going very > far anyway. However the console is up when it happens. cpu_idle_poll_ctrl(true) should solve that problem.
